【Author】
Mohsenzadeh, Ali; Bidgoly, Amir Jalaly; Farjami, Yaghoub
【Source】COMPUTER COMMUNICATIONS
【Abstract】Distributed ledger technology (DLT) has emerged as a key and effective technology which has caught the attention of variety of disciplines and is capable of changing lots of sciences and related industries. Selecting the transactions of members in DLT-based technologies such as blockchain, especially in finance, is essential and vital. Therefore, in this paper, we present a novel framework for selecting members' transactions through trust and reputation models called the reputation-based consensus framework (RCF), so that by combining trust and reputation models with blockchain, the target node (or verifier), which has the highest reputation based on its transactions history, is selected to create and publish the current block of blockchain. We have also provided a state machine model to accurately describe the behavior of the RCF. In addition, the RCF algorithms are presented and a prototype is developed based on it. The results of simulation and performance and security analysis proved that RCF leads to fair selection of transactions, improves scalability and throughput, and can resist against attacks such as Sybil and malicious behaviors.
【Keywords】Distributed ledger technology; Blockchain; Consensus mechanisms; Framework; Trust and reputation models
【标题】分布式账本技术中一种新颖的基于信誉的共识框架(RCF)
【摘要】分布式账本技术(DLT)已成为一项关键且有效的技术,引起了各学科的关注,并能够改变许多科学和相关行业。在区块链等基于 DLT 的技术中选择成员的交易,尤其是在金融领域,是必不可少的。因此,在本文中,我们提出了一种通过信任和声誉模型选择成员交易的新框架,称为基于声誉的共识框架(RCF),通过将信任和声誉模型与区块链相结合,目标节点(或验证者) ,根据其交易历史具有最高声誉,被选为创建和发布当前区块链区块。我们还提供了一个状态机模型来准确描述 RCF 的行为。此外,还提出了RCF算法,并在此基础上开发了原型。仿真和性能和安全分析的结果证明,RCF导致交易的公平选择,提高了可扩展性和吞吐量,并且可以抵抗Sybil和恶意行为等攻击。
【关键词】分布式账本技术;区块链;共识机制;框架;信任和声誉模型
评论